Bear Mount details
Bear Location

Travel to the area northwest of the Sanctum of Penitence, close to Unicorn Cliff; the bear appears at a fixed spawn point very near a fast travel node, which makes repeated attempts convenient.

Look for the large brown bear roaming a small clearing near the cliffside and the fast travel marker.

How to prepare before engaging the bear
- Stock meat in your inventory: bring at least one stack of any meat to feed the bear once mounted.
-
Equip a weapon with controlled damage so you can gradually reduce the bear’s health without killing it.
-
Save or set a nearby respawn point so you can repeat the process quickly if the attempt fails.
How to get the bear into a mountable state
Step 1
Approach the spawn cautiously and engage the bear with light, measured attacks so you only chip away at its health.

Step 2
Avoid burst damage or strong skills that risk an accidental kill; your aim is to push the bear into a weakened, staggered state where an interaction prompt appears.

Step 3
When the mount interaction prompt shows, immediately use it to climb onto the bear before it recovers.

How to feed and raise trust
Step 4
While mounted, open your inventory and highlight a meat item you want to feed.
Step 5
Hold the feed button shown in the control prompts (controller: A; keyboard: the interact/feed key) to present the meat and feed it to the bear.

Step 6
Continue feeding meat until the trust meter reaches 100; repeated feedings are required and the meter fills incrementally.

When the trust meter reaches 100 the bear becomes a registered mount in your mounts list and can be summoned like any other mount. After registration, you can call the bear from the mount menu and ride it normally.

Tips and troubleshooting
-
If you accidentally kill the bear, respawn at the nearby fast travel and try again.
-
If you struggle to stagger the bear, switch to lower-damage skills or weaker weapons to avoid overkill.
-
Keep several stacks of meat to avoid running out mid-attempt.
-
Approach from cover or use hit-and-run tactics to bait the bear into the mountable state safely.
